在数字化的世界中,网络安全成为了我们无法忽视的重要问题,为了保护用户的信息安全,HTTPS安全超文本传输协议应运而生,作为一名主机评测专家,我将在本文中深入探讨HTTPS协议的工作原理,以及它如何确保我们的在线活动安全。
我们需要了解HTTP和HTTPS的基本区别,HTTP(超文本传输协议)是一种用于分布式、协作式和超媒体信息系统的应用层协议,它是整个Web的数据通信的基础,HTTP协议在数据传输过程中并未进行任何加密处理,这就意味着,任何在网络上监听或拦截HTTP数据包的人都可以轻易地查看到传输的内容。
为了解决这个问题,HTTPS协议应运而生,HTTPS是HTTP的安全版,它在HTTP的基础上添加了SSL/TLS协议,为数据的传输提供了安全的保障,SSL(安全套接层)和TLS(传输层安全)都是用于在网络中提供加密和数据完整性的安全协议。
当用户通过浏览器访问一个使用HTTPS协议的网站时,服务器会返回一个包含公钥的数字证书,这个证书是由权威的证书颁发机构(CA)签发的,用于证明服务器的身份,浏览器会使用CA的公钥来加密一个随机生成的对称密钥,并将其发送给服务器,服务器使用自己的私钥来解密这个对称密钥,所有的后续通信都会使用这个对称密钥来进行加密和解密。
这种方式的好处在于,即使有人拦截到了这个对称密钥,由于他们没有CA的私钥,也无法解密出原始的对称密钥,他们仍然无法查看到传输的内容,这就大大提高了数据传输的安全性。
HTTPS协议还支持双向认证,也就是说,服务器不仅可以验证客户端的身份,还可以验证客户端是否被授权访问特定的资源,这进一步增强了HTTPS协议的安全性。
HTTPS安全超文本传输协议通过使用SSL/TLS协议,提供了一个安全的数据传输通道,有效地保护了用户的信息安全,我们也需要注意,虽然HTTPS协议可以提供安全的数据传输,如果网站的安全配置不当,或者用户的设备被恶意软件感染,用户的信息安全仍然可能受到威胁,我们需要时刻保持警惕,确保我们的在线活动的安全。